Create the World You Imagine

People tend to focus on their own beliefs, building support for those beliefs by seeing what they want to see. For most people, the reality in the world shows up pretty much as we expect it to, but when you focus on what shouldn’t be or how you don’t have enough of something, you’ll notice and focus on the evidence to support that belief. We've all met people who have plenty of reasons why they can't do something, but they have few reasons why they can. They can't see the forest for the trees of negativity.

When you focus on what you do have or what you can do, your power to attract expands and you experience and see the options to go forward more clearly. While you aren’t able to control your circumstances, or the obstacles put in your path, you can always control your reaction to them.

This simple formula is worth remembering. To soar and create an extraordinary future, these two concepts give you the keys to begin.

What You Focus Upon Expands

In every moment of your life, you can transform your reality. It is as simple as changing your mind, your perception. Simple, yes. Easy? Not always. You can choose: What can you do in a situation? Let go of what you don’t have control over and focus on what you can do. Think of all the energy spent in replaying what we can’t change. Use that energy to go forward. Accept what is and focus on what you do have, what working, what has gotten done.

ACTION TIP: This week, listen to yourself. Each time you notice your thoughts or words expressing want or lack of something - time, money, love, etc., STOP. Then rephrase what you have said to create a positive or take an action that will shift your present reality.

For instance, if you feel you never have enough time and you are perpetually rushing or late, arrive 15 minutes early to each appointment. You’ll begin to experience the feeling of being in control of your time and having enough. As your perception shifts and your internal conversation shifts, the outward reality begins to shift. It may take some getting used to, though. When I changed from rushing and being driven by tight, adrenaline-driven deadlines, to arriving early for appointments, I kept feeling like I was forgetting something! In fact my mind just needed some time to adjust to the new reality!

Feed Gratitude for What You Have

Some days it feels like there is not much to smile about. When you have lost a listing or a deal is falling through, it can frustrate and leave you feeling upset and stressed. Recent events in Colorado, Oklahoma and Kosovo serve to remind us to put it all in perspective. Living in the richest nation in the world, it is easy to forget that there are people who don’t have food or housing. Taking for granted our good health or a loved one is easy until we face the reality of loss.

ACTION TIP: Focus on what you have: List each day at least 5 items you are grateful for. As you are more aware and appreciative of what you do have, you will shift from the external blame game to the internal personal power of responsibility.
